Massimiliano Rega is an entrepreneur and strategic consultant with more than 20 years of expertise in transforming businesses by aligning resources, operations, and sales within digital and omnichannel frameworks. His proficiency lies in synchronizing talent, partners, and knowledge, leading initiatives that revolutionize customer experiences. Massimiliano has fostered harmony between Digital, eCommerce, Telesales, and Retail channels, driving innovation and sustainable growth.
Over his career, he has held critical leadership roles in globally renowned organizations. As Senior Executive of Customer Experience, Service & Delivery at SKY, reporting directly to the CEO, he crafted one of the world's most integrated sales and delivery systems, enhancing operational efficiency and customer satisfaction. In his role as Chief Operating Officer (COO) at Technogym, he contributed to the company’s international growth and stock market achievements, unlocking new strategic markets and optimizing omnichannel sales processes. At PG Italy, he pioneered the country’s largest network of digital professionals, comprising 1,500 technicians, 180 retail locations, and 110 warehouses, showcasing the power of collaborative distribution networks.
Since 2018, Massimiliano has applied his expertise through MRC OmniChannel, combining consulting with entrepreneurial projects across Europe, the Middle East, and Asia. He has collaborated with top global brands like Motorola and Lenovo and initiated ventures such as Immoveo, an eco-real estate project, and SDEN, a fiber optics leader, culminating in a highly successful exit. His PhD work on omnichannel strategies led to the creation of RTBH.ai, an AI-driven Decision Support System (DSS) that uses neuroscience to evaluate brand health in real-time.
Massimiliano holds a degree in Mechanical Engineering from the University of Rome Tor Vergata and co-founded Alitur, an alumni association for engineering graduates in Rome. Since 2017, he has been serving as an Adjunct Professor of Business Economics and Organization.
